Introduction: Superoxide radicals and oxidized low-density lipoproteins (oxLDL) has been proved to play a role in decreased NO-dependent vasodilator function in hypercholesterolemia and atherosclerosis. The 8-isoprostaglandin F2a is one of the most valid markers of in-vivo oxidative stress. We aimed to investigate the preventive and treatment effect of dietary supplementation of L-arginine (3 in drinking water) by measuring 8-isoprostaglandin F2a as a marker of oxidative stress. Materials and Methods: Rabbits were randomized to four experimental groups (n= 6*4): Control, Prevention, Treatment and Prevention & Treatment. All of them received hypercholesterolemic diet for the first four weeks. The Prevention group received supplementary L-arginine in the first four weeks, the Treatment group received L-arginine in the second four weeks and the Prevention & Treatment group received L-arginine throughout the experiment. The serum level of lipids and lipoproteins and fatty streaks were measured during the experiment. To determine the antiatherosclerotic effects of L-arginine the 8-isoprostaglandin F2a levels were measured using the ELISA method in the Results: No significant differences were observed for the serum levels of lipids and lipoproteins between the groups during the experiment. The serum concentration of 8-isoprostaglandin F2a was significantly decreased in the Prevention group rather than the Control group at the end of the experiment. The IMT ratio in the Prevention group was significantly lower than the Control group at the end of the experiment. Conclusion: In fact there is a preventive role for L-arginine in our hypercholesterolemic models.
